AddMultiplicationEquality被限制为只有2个变量是因为它是用于表示线性规划问题中的等式约束的函数。在线性规划中,等式约束通常是指将多个变量的乘积相加等于一个常数的约束条件。
限制AddMultiplicationEquality只有2个变量的原因是为了简化问题的复杂性。在实际应用中,大多数线性规划问题中的等式约束都是两个变量的乘积相加等于一个常数。这种限制使得问题的建模和求解更加高效和简单。
然而,如果需要表示多个变量的乘积相加等于一个常数的约束,可以使用其他方法来实现。例如,可以将多个变量的乘积表示为新的变量,并使用AddEquality函数将其与常数相等。
在腾讯云的产品中,与线性规划相关的服务包括腾讯云优化器(Tencent Cloud Optimizer)和腾讯云数学优化引擎(Tencent Cloud Mathematical Optimization Engine)。这些产品提供了丰富的线性规划建模和求解功能,可以满足不同场景下的需求。
更多关于腾讯云优化器的信息,请访问:腾讯云优化器产品介绍
更多关于腾讯云数学优化引擎的信息,请访问:腾讯云数学优化引擎产品介绍
领取专属 10元无门槛券
手把手带您无忧上云